PUK PROXY MET WITH PYD ABOUT GENEVA

 The PUK-affiliated Kurdish Democratic Progressive Party in Syria (Partiya Demokrat a Pêşverû ya Kurdî li Sûriyê) met with PYD organizations to discuss the upcoming Geneva conference and how the Kurds will participate in the conference. The question mark is now how the Syrian Kurds will participate in the conference, since the Kurdish National Council (KNC) joined the Syrian opposition coalition, while the PYD is part of the National Coordination Body (NCB). The Talabani-affiliated party used to cooperate with the PYD and joined their security organizations, but left them after the incident in Amuda. Strangely, while the PUK still supports the PYD, it’s Syrian Kurdish affiliate joined the Syrian coalition.
